Trapezoid Formulas
Median (m) = (a + b) / 2
Area = m × h
Perimeter = a + b + c + d
Where a and b are the two parallel bases, h is the perpendicular height, c and d are the non-parallel sides (legs), and m is the median (midline).
Example
Trapezoid with bases 8 cm and 5 cm, height 4 cm
Area = ½ × (8 + 5) × 4 = ½ × 13 × 4 = 26 cm²
Median = (8 + 5) / 2 = 6.5 cm
Types of Trapezoids
| Type | Description |
|---|---|
| Right trapezoid | One leg is perpendicular to the bases (one right angle) |
| Isosceles trapezoid | Both legs are equal in length; base angles are equal |
| Scalene trapezoid | No special symmetry; all sides different |
| Parallelogram | Special case: both pairs of sides are parallel (a = b would make it a rectangle) |
Frequently Asked Questions
What is the difference between a trapezoid and a trapezium?
In North America (US/Canada), a trapezoid has exactly one pair of parallel sides. In the UK and much of the world, this same shape is called a trapezium. The terms refer to the same shape — just different regional conventions.
Why does the formula use the average of the two bases?
The trapezoid area formula ½×(a+b)×h comes from averaging the two base lengths to find the "average width," then multiplying by height. You can also see this as the area of a rectangle with width = median and height = h.
What if the trapezoid has legs of different lengths?
The area formula only requires the two parallel bases and the height — the leg lengths don't affect the area. However, you need all four sides for the perimeter. The optional leg fields in this calculator let you find the perimeter when you know those measurements.
